William Neal Floyd, 91, of the McHue Community in Batesville died Thursday, January 13, 2005 in Batesville. He was born October 20, 1913 in Floral, Arkansas, the son of J. B. Floyd and Gertrude Massey Floyd. He was a farmer, a member of the Independence County Election Commission, a Mason, and a member of the McHue Methodist Church. He is survived by his son, John Freddie Floyd of Benton; a brother Ray Dean Floyd of Jamestown; a sister, Sharon Candler of Allen's Chapel; three grandchildren, Dr. Dennis Floyd and his wife, Rebecca; Sue Carper, and her husband, Bobby; Jalane Fitzhugh and her husband Gary. He was preceded in death by his parents; his wife, Ida Floyd; two brothers, Hershel Floyd and Norman Floyd; four sisters, Ruth Pearson, Belah Platt, Mary Hunter, and Hazel Bishop; and a daughter-in-law, Evelyn Floyd.
